Elemis debuts anti-blue light skincare onboard new cruise ship Celebrity Beyond

In the modern world, everyone is on their phone experiencing blue light as well as high-stress levels
– Oriele Frank

Elemis launched its new skincare product, Pro-collagen Morning Matrix, onboard Celebrity Cruises’ new ship Celebrity Beyond, in association with sea spa specialists OneSpaWorld.

Following a UK launch in London the day before, the international event was held on Celebrity Beyond during the media “shakedown” cruise, one day ahead of her maiden voyage in Western Europe, departing Southampton.

Elemis has partnered with Celebrity Cruises and One Spa World on each of the cruise line’s Edge-class ships: Celebrity Edge, Celebrity Apex and now Celebrity Beyond.

Having completed clinical trials, the product will be rolled out on Celebrity Beyond first and then across the rest of the fleet.

Oriele Frank, co-founder and chief product and sustainability officer at Elemis, said: “In the modern world, everyone is on their phone experiencing blue light as well as high-stress levels, both of which impact skin. These two factors are what motivated the development of this product.”

The silicone-free anti-ageing daytime moisturiser has been formulated to protect against the effects of blue light, visible signs of skin ageing, fine lines, wrinkles and to improve skin firmness and elasticity.

“The hours we spend on our laptop or phone add up – it’s seven-days-a-week, 16-17 hours a day,” added Krystina Dwyer, head of treatment development at Elemis.

“We’re using Padina Pavonica Ferment – this ensures we’re delivering maximum moisture to the skin and supporting collagen, that elastic feeling of firmness and relaxed appearance to the skin.”

Dwyer explained that additional ingredients include turmeric curcuma longa, which protects collagen and elastin from stress-induced degradation.

Japanese artemisia capillaris is also used to counter the impact of blue light on the skin.

Wellness onboard Celebrity Beyond

Celebrity Beyond’s spa offers a menu complete with more than 120 treatments, including acupuncture (the line’s most popular spa service), cupping and Gharieni’s MLX iDome concept.

It also offers a sea thermal suite, with the elements of sea, earth and air inspiring the design, which was led by Kelly Hoppen.

There are eight spaces to experience overall, including a hammam, crystalarium, salt room, infrared sauna room and a rainfall water therapy room.

Guests can access the spa area by booking an AquaClass stateroom, or by reserving one of the top three suites. Guests not in either of these categories can purchase a day pass which are capped at 40 daily.

At 1,073ft, Celebrity Beyond is the largest ship in the Edge-class fleet with capacity for 3,260 guests in 1,646 staterooms.

As well as access to the sea thermal suite and spa, AquaClass’s immersion into wellness also includes pillow menus, a cashmere mattress, preferential rates on spa packages, in-room fitness amenities and a complimentary pass to the vast Technogym fitness centre.

Elemis Ltd
Elemis was created in 1990 as a lifestyle brand of aromatherapy products aimed at treating each person holistically with plant essential oils and marine extracts mixed in natural bases. As well as supplying a wide range of products to over 1,600 spas worldwide, the company also runs its own day spas.
